How are risks related to the supply chain and sustainability addressed in companies in the textile and clothing sector in Peru?
In companies in the textile and clothing sector in Peru, due diligence in supply chain and sustainability involves reviewing working conditions in factories, ethical sourcing practices, and measures to guarantee the sustainability of materials. Fair trade certifications, transparency in the supply chain, and the company's ability to adopt sustainable practices in the production of textiles and clothing are analyzed.

What is gender violence in Venezuela?
Gender violence in Venezuela refers to physical, sexual, psychological or patrimonial violence that is exercised against a person due to their gender. This form of violence is based on power inequalities and mainly affects women.
